Beef brisket is taken from the lower chest of a cow – it's a tough cut of meat that, with a long and lingering cook, yields fall-apart results. WebMar 2, 2024 · Give it at least 15 minutes, but 20 minutes is even better for the juiciest meat ( this is when locking in the moisture matters). After resting, slice your meat against the grain. This is especially important with tougher cuts like brisket that are made up of long, strong muscle strands.
